CNC laser cutting technology offers significant advantages in various industries. One key benefit is precision. Laser cutting machines can achieve tolerances as tight as ±0.1 mm. This means less material waste and higher quality products. In fact, studies show that companies using CNC laser cutting technology can reduce scrap rates by up to 30%.
Another advantage is speed. These machines can cut through materials at speeds ranging from 1 to 30 meters per minute, depending on the thickness and type of material. This efficiency translates to better productivity and shorter lead times. A survey from industry experts indicated that firms adopting CNC laser cutting methods saw a 25% increase in production rates.
However, challenges remain. Not every material is suitable for laser cutting. Some thicker metals may require alternative methods. Laser systems also demand regular maintenance, increasing operational costs. Companies must balance these factors against the clear advantages. CNC laser cutting has transformed manufacturing. Compared to traditional cutting methods, it offers precision and efficiency. The ability to cut detailed designs is impressive. Lasers can handle various materials, like metal, wood, and plastic.
Traditional methods often struggle with intricate cuts. Sawing or punching may leave rough edges. The CNC laser, however, creates clean finishes. This reduces the need for additional processing. Time and costs are crucial in manufacturing. CNC laser cutting speeds up production significantly.
Yet, not everything is perfect. Initial setup costs for CNC laser machines can be high. Smaller businesses may find this challenging. Training personnel is also essential.
